         During its 8th Session held on December 18, 2020, the Scientific Advisory Council of the EU Malaria Fund has included VicuTec Biologicals GmbH to the Fund's portfolio. The EU Malaria Fund is a public-private partnership between the European Union, International Organizations, corporations, and organized civic society, providing a novel funding instrument to address market failures in infectious diseases with significant relevance to public health globally.
